CAMP SEASON ENDED WITH VOLUNTEER POWER!

Summer camp at the Y was filled with fun and adventure for hundreds of children each day. Campers enjoyed basketball, volleyball, archery, mountain biking, trail walking, arts & crafts, science projects, games, swimming, and so much more. But the best part was making new friends, reconnecting with old ones, and learning new things.

All good things must come to an end—at least for the season. While camp wrapped up on a Thursday, the next day was devoted to packing up and cleaning out after nine weeks of nonstop activity—because the following Monday marked the start of our before and after school programs.

With the help of PeoplesBank, games were packed, craft supplies organized, buildings cleaned and swept, and the last trash cans emptied. We are so grateful to the PeoplesBank volunteers who came to Camp Weber to help close out the season. Their time, energy, and muscle made for a much lighter load for our staff on the final day.
